An Adjunct Study to Assess Guided ADHD Therapy for Managing the Extent and Severity of Symptoms
An Adjunct Study to Assess Guided ADHD Therapy for Managing the Extent and Severity of Symptoms - A Prospective, Multicenter, Open Label, Single Arm, Intervention Study to Assess Efficacy and Safety of an At-home, Game-based Digital Therapy for Treating Clinical Symptoms of Adult Patients With Attention-Deficit/Hyperactivity Disorder (ADHD)

Summary
The objective of this study is to assess the safety and effectiveness of an at-home, game-based digital therapy for treating adult patients with Attention-Deficit/Hyperactivity Disorder (ADHD).
